Description

(3,3,3-Trifluoropropyl)methyldichlorosilane (CAS No. 675-62-7) is a highly specialized organosilicon compound with the molecular formula C4H7Cl2F3Si. This reactive silane is characterized by its dichlorosilane functional group and a 3,3,3-trifluoropropyl moiety, making it a valuable intermediate in the synthesis of fluorinated silicones and surface-modifying agents. The compound is a clear, colorless to pale yellow liquid with a pungent odor, and it is moisture-sensitive, requiring storage under inert conditions.

Researchers and industrial chemists utilize this silane for its ability to introduce both fluorinated and silane functionalities into polymers, coatings, and adhesives, enhancing properties such as hydrophobicity, chemical resistance, and thermal stability. It is particularly useful in the preparation of advanced materials for aerospace, electronics, and high-performance coatings. Due to its reactivity, handling should be performed in a controlled environment with appropriate safety measures.

Properties

  • CAS Number: 675-62-7
  • Complexity: 112
  • IUPAC Name: dichloro-methyl-(3,3,3-trifluoropropyl)silane
  • InChI: InChI=1S/C4H7Cl2F3Si/c1-10(5,6)3-2-4(7,8)9/h2-3H2,1H3
  • InChI Key: OHABWQNEJUUFAV-UHFFFAOYSA-N
  • Exact Mass: 209.9646166
  • Molecular Formula: C4H7Cl2F3Si
  • Molecular Weight: 211.08
  • SMILES: C[Si](CCC(F)(F)F)(Cl)Cl
  • Monoisotopic Mass: 209.9646166
  • Physical Description: Liquid

Application

(3,3,3-Trifluoropropyl)methyldichlorosilane is widely used as a key precursor in the synthesis of fluorinated silicone polymers, which exhibit exceptional resistance to solvents, oils, and extreme temperatures. It serves as a surface-modifying agent to impart hydrophobic and oleophobic properties to glass, metals, and ceramics. The compound is also employed in the production of specialty adhesives and sealants for demanding environments, such as aerospace and automotive industries.
